Also the idea that Linda Keith gave Jimi a guitar owned by Keith Richards: and that this 'started Jimi off' is absurd... Richards says himself in his autobiography that he and Linda split long before she met Hendrix (she didn't even leave Keef for Jimi. There were others before him). The guitar credit claim is ludicrous: Every Hendrix fan knows Jimi played guitar long before he came to England. Jimi played his guitar when he was in the army (ask Billy Cox!). Jimi was a guitarist before he knew Ms. Keith existed...
